Aam Aadmi Party on Saturday accused the BJP of trying to deceive the Election Commission by submitting faux voter registration purposes in giant numbers from the residential addresses of its leaders. Addressing a press convention, AAP Rajya Sabha MP Sanjay Singh claimed that dozens of voter registration purposes had been filed from single small outlets and basements.
He additionally accused the BJP of submitting a number of new voter registration purposes utilizing the residential addresses of their leaders. “This is the reality of the biggest political party in India. This is how Prime Minister Modi’s party plans to win the elections,” Singh stated, itemizing the names of BJP leaders, together with union ministers, for his or her alleged involvement within the concern.
“The BJP and its leaders are trying to deceive the Election Commission. This is BJP’s election scam, being carried out by their Union ministers and MPs, and they are undermining the integrity of the Election Commission,” Singh added.
Delhi heads to the ballot on February 5 and outcomes shall be declared on February 8.
